轻量应用服务器能否安装MySQL数据库:深度解析与探讨
结论:
在当今的云计算和互联网环境中,轻量级应用服务器因其资源占用低、部署快速、成本效益高等特点,逐渐成为许多小型企业和个人开发者的选择。然而,一个常见的问题是,这些轻量级服务器是否能够支持像MySQL这样的关系型数据库?答案是肯定的,但其性能、配置以及管理方式可能会有所不同。这里将深入探讨这一问题。
分析探讨:
首先,我们来明确一下什么是轻量应用服务器。轻量级应用服务器通常是指那些专为Web应用设计,硬件需求较低,运行效率高,易于部署和管理的服务器。它们通常拥有较小的内存和CPU资源,适合承载对计算性能要求不高的网站或API服务。
对于MySQL数据库来说,它是一种开源的关系型数据库管理系统,虽然在处理大规模并发和复杂查询时可能需要更强大的硬件支持,但对于轻量级应用而言,许多情况下是可以胜任的。特别是当你的应用数据量不大,业务逻辑简单,访问频率适中时,MySQL的性能足以满足需求。
然而,安装MySQL在轻量应用服务器上需要注意以下几点:
-
硬件配置:尽管轻量级服务器硬件资源有限,但确保足够的内存和磁盘空间对于数据库的运行至关重要。你需要根据预期的数据量和访问量,合理分配内存和磁盘I/O资源。
-
配置优化:MySQL有许多可调参数,如缓冲区大小、连接数限制等,需要根据服务器性能进行适当调整。对于轻量级服务器,可能需要降低一些默认设置以提高效率。
-
安全性:轻量服务器由于资源受限,安全措施可能会相对薄弱,所以在安装MySQL时,要确保使用最新的版本,并启用必要的防火墙规则和加密措施。
-
扩展性:如果未来业务发展,数据量和访问压力增大,可能需要考虑升级到更强大的服务器或者使用数据库集群。轻量级服务器可能难以应对这种增长。
-
管理工具:选择一款适合轻量级环境的数据库管理工具也很重要,例如,MySQL Workbench或命令行工具,以确保高效运维。
总结:
总的来说,轻量应用服务器可以安装MySQL数据库,但这并不意味着所有场景都适用。在选择和配置过程中,需要充分考虑应用的实际需求、服务器的硬件能力以及未来的扩展性。同时,合理利用资源、优化配置、保障安全性,都是确保轻量级服务器与MySQL良好协同的关键因素。
秒懂云